WebDec 1, 2024 · Comprehensive guidance on reporting is provided in the RCPath dataset for histological reporting of cervical neoplasia, with advice on the approach required to accurately and consistently classify and stage cancers to provide prognostic information and inform clinical management. 10 This requires systematic measurement and … WebBefore starting the treatment, your colposcopist will touch your cervix to check it is numb. Having the treatment. Once your cervix is numb, your colposcopist uses the loop to remove the area of your cervix that has cell changes. It is normal to notice a slight burning smell and hear a noise like a soft vacuum cleaner. WebMar 6, 2024 · Strong and diffuse block staining for p16 supports a categorization of precancerous disease. Any identified p16 positive area must meet H&E morphologic criteria for a high grade lesion to reinterpreted as such. ( Arch Pathol Lab Med 2012;136:1266 ) Comment Here.
